A septic tank serves as the initial stage of a decentralized wastewater treatment system, receiving all household effluent. Its primary function is to facilitate the separation of solid waste, which settles as sludge, and lighter materials, which float as scum. The partially treated liquid effluent then flows out of the tank for further treatment, preventing the direct discharge of untreated wastewater into the environment.

The typical lifespan of a septic tank in Oregon can extend for several decades, provided it receives consistent and appropriate maintenance. The durability of the tank materials themselves, such as reinforced concrete or high-density polyethylene, contributes to this longevity. However, the overall system's effectiveness is also dependent on the proper functioning of the drain field, which requires regular pumping and attention to prevent premature failure.
In Oregon, septic tanks generally require pumping every three to five years, depending on household water usage and the tank's volume. For a typical family of four, this interval often suffices. However, properties with higher occupancy or those utilizing smaller tank systems may necessitate more frequent servicing to prevent the accumulation of solids and scum, which could otherwise overload the drain field.
